Change the App Lock Password or Security Questions
Enter the App Lock settings screen, go to
> P
assword type, and select Lock screen
password or Custom PIN as the App Lock password.
If you select Custom PIN, you can go on to set a new password and security questions.

Enable Smart Unlock
Smart Unlock enables you to unlock your phone with a Bluetooth device, such as a smart
band. When a compatible Bluetooth device is detected, you can then unlock your phone with
a simple swipe.
1 Pair your phone with the Bluetooth device.
2 On your phone, go to Settings > Biometrics & password > Smart Unlock, and enable
Smart Unlock.
3 Follow the onscreen instructions to set the lock screen password. Skip setting the lock
screen password if a lock screen password has already been set.
4 From the Paired devices list, touch the name of the device you would like to use for
Smart Unlock, and follow the onscreen instructions to set it as the Unlocking device.
